Output 76019c06d698076aa7ffcbe3ef9213b8024a7544145ecb1174a46f444c62fe85:84

value
31608
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25ff5a3a4b8bcb8a64e301fbf69359f29905f2c9 OP_EQUAL
address
359vpqizmVEJ36pFsRky5h3ExAVic9BwKj
transaction
76019c06d698076aa7ffcbe3ef9213b8024a7544145ecb1174a46f444c62fe85